The removal of remaining foam sealant, which is sometimes used between a vehicle’s fender and body for noise, vibration, and harshness (NVH) purposes, is an additional labor task that is not included in standard repair procedures. This task is often necessary for clean-up and proper repair.
Key Considerations
- OEM Procedures: Always refer to the original equipment manufacturer (OEM) service information for the correct product type and application procedures for the sealant.
- DEG Inquiry: A recent DEG inquiry 39752 specifically addresses this issue on a Ford Explorer, confirming that this labor is separate.
